I am veteran player of both Gw1 and Gw2. I’d consider myself rather hardcore player, i pretty much quit playing gw2(i was still logging in for few dungeons a week) after ~8 months after i got my third legendary.

Ascended gear was one of the biggest let downs for me. I didn’t expect Anet to break their great rule of “no gear treadmill” which was the rule that hooked me to Gw1. I knew that everyone has an easy access to max level gear(just like gw2 pre ascended gear) and the only thing that matters is skill and teamwork. I knew that we all have same stats and our only advantage is our creativity and knowledge of the game. Just look at builds like 55 Monk, that was a really creative build. You didn’t have to play 12 hours a day to be good and beat hardest content.

Now regarding Gw2. Since ascended gear mattered the most in Fractals i was not bothered that much. I simply don’t like em. Now when raids are part of HoT i am extremely disappointed that players who just spent hours/days on crafting gear(which is not hard, it just reacquires fookin grind) have power advantage over players who just don’t want to spend their time on grinding.

This is it. Adding gear that gives you power advantage and at the same time reacquires significant amounts of time to craft is simply breaking the rule of “no gear treadmill”. Your power should be your mechanical skills and your knowledge which imo are the most important features of a great player. Ascended gear screwed their policy and there is no way to go back now, there will always be losers regardless what they will do.

There are only legendary weapons currently.

When you hit level 80 your first goal should be to get exotic set. It’s relatively easy until you will come up with some crazy build that requires extremely expensive runes. You can buy it straight from trading post.

Ascended gear has better stats than exotics(not much tho). This one will take you a while.

Then it’s just hunting for cool skins to make your exotic/ascended set look awesome.

Regarding weapons – legendary and ascended weapons have the same stats. Legendary weapons have an option to change stat spec at any time(to better suit different builds) and look pretty cool.
